Tasting notes
Very young and unevolved both times I was able to taste it, the inky hued 2023 Château Soutard offers a ripe, powerful nose of mineral-laced red and blue fruits as well as ample scorched earth, violets, graphite, and floral nuances. Medium to full-bodied, concentrated, and textured, with a brilliant sense of minerality, it has the concentration and structure to warrant a solid 4-5 years of bottle age. The quality at this château continues to skyrocket.

Licorice, flowers, black cherries, and chocolate define the core of this wine. The wine is elegant, creamy, fresh, pure, and precise, The finish combines silky tannins, crushed stones, and fresh, red fruits.
The 2023 Soutard is deep garnet-purple in color. It needs a lot of swirling to unlock notes of juicy plums and blackberry preserves, followed by nuances of Sichuan pepper, violets, and black olives. Medium to full-bodied, the palate is plush and juicy, with fantastic tension and a fragrant finish.
The concentration of fruit here is formidable, with blackberries, blueberries and hints of cedar and flowers. Full-bodied, yet with a refined and polished texture and a flavorful finish. Cool character to this.
